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 5952, here are decompositions:

  • 13 + 5939 = 5952
  • 29 + 5923 = 5952
  • 71 + 5881 = 5952
  • 73 + 5879 = 5952
  • 83 + 5869 = 5952
  • 101 + 5851 = 5952
  • 103 + 5849 = 5952
  • 109 + 5843 = 5952

Showing the first eight; more decompositions exist.
